So for this Ident thing I've finally finished off the animatic after being sent a song by a band back in my hometown of High Wycombe called Book Club, who have given me permission to use their song 'Centuries' and it's pretty much right on the money music wise for my animation.

Its only got rough character designs in but the colour/timings of the squares zooming out is how I want it, just the tweens were making things awkward and I wanted to just get the timings out so I didn't bother doing the zooms just yet. Also the 'pulsing' effect that I want on the glowing walls I think I'm going to do on After Effects so thats not in yet either.
